Cardiff and Swansea leading the way with the highest numbers of new cases...

There have been 2,492 new cases of coronavirus reported today by PHW bringing the total cases to 447,655. There were coronavirus deaths reported by PHW so the total number of deaths has risen to 6,184. The infection rate in Wales now stands at 546.2 per 100,000 people a small fall on the 548.2 reported on Tuesday.  For more information on the Covid figures released on Monday go to Wales Online...


The area with the highest infection rate is Torfaen with 761 cases per 100,000 people followed by Vale of Glamorgan with 741.8 and Caerphilly with 730.1 cases per 100,000 people. Hywel Dda Health Board shows 197 cases reported today with 104 in Carmarthenshire, 66 in Pembrokeshire and 27 in Ceredigion.
